Cubic Kilometer
A cubic kilometer (km^3) is a unit of volume representing the volume of a cube with edges of one kilometer in length.
History/Origin
The cubic kilometer has been used in scientific and engineering contexts to measure large volumes, especially in geology, hydrology, and environmental sciences, as a convenient unit for expressing vast quantities of water, earth, or other materials.
Current Use
Today, the cubic kilometer is primarily used in fields such as hydrology to quantify large-scale water volumes, like reservoirs and aquifers, and in geology and environmental science to measure large volumes of earth or other substances.
Board Foot
A board foot is a unit of volume measurement for lumber, representing a volume of 1 foot long by 1 foot wide by 1 inch thick.
History/Origin
The board foot originated in the United States in the 19th century as a standard measurement for lumber industry, simplifying trade and inventory calculations.
Current Use
It is still widely used in the lumber and woodworking industries to quantify and price wood volumes, especially in North America.
